Plugin authors: the base image for the Quillbark runtime moved from the full Debian build to a distroless variant last sprint. Expect roughly 60% smaller pulls. If your plugin relies on shell utilities or apt packages, declare them in the manifest's tools block instead; the builder injects them at assembly time. Multi-stage examples are in the plugin SDK docs. Layer-cache quirks on the Veldway CI runners are documented in the runbook. Questions about the slimming pipeline should go to the engineer named below.

approver of yafog-kajog = Ralael Quenmir

Handover — Vexler partner SFTP drop

Ownership moves to you today. Drop runs hourly from Vexler's end into the intake bucket via the relay host. Watch for zero-byte files; their exporter flakes on Mondays. Creds live in the ops vault, path noted in the runbook. Vault auto-seals after 48h idle. Support escalations go to the on-call rotation, not me. If the vault is sealed when you need it, unseal with the recovery passphrase below.

recovery phrase for tadug-fafof: zorwyn-kasion

**Mgmt Meeting Minutes — Retiring the Brightline Range**

Quick recap for sales leads at Fenholt Supplies: we agreed to retire the Brightline fixture range by year-end. Remaining stock moves to clearance pricing next month, and accounts on standing orders get migrated to the Lumetta range. Trade-in incentives were approved in principle. The confidential note on next steps sits just below.

board note of bajof-bajeg: The pricing group signed off on a budget of $13.4 million for Project Sildor. The renewal with Lamixek Holdings closes at $48.9 million a year, 49 percent above the last contract.

Audit item 7 — Shipping fee rules engine (Cartwright module)

Confirm that every active rule in the Tollgate engine carries a documented justification, an effective date, and a rollback path. Verify the staging replay matched production outputs for the last full billing cycle. Any deviation must be recorded and countersigned before release. The accountable owner is named below.

named custodian: Belius Casath Ulaix Sorius